Dickey, Georgia

Unincorporated community in Georgia, U.S.

Dickey is an unincorporated community in Calhoun County, in the U.S. state of Georgia.[1]

History

A variant name was "Whitney".[1] A post office called Dickey was established in 1889, and remained in operation until 1919.[2]

The Georgia General Assembly incorporated Dickey as a town in 1900.[3] The town's municipal charter was repealed in 1995.[4]
